Specialist Care for Audi DSG Transmission Repair
The Direct Shift Gearbox (DSG), also known as the S-Tronic in many Audi models, is a marvel of speed and efficiency. By using two clutches to pre-select gears, it offers lightning-fast shifts. However, this complexity makes Audi DSG transmission repair a task for experts. The clutches and mechatronic units are sensitive to fluid quality and temperature. In the UAE, where stop-and-go traffic in 45-degree heat is common, the DSG fluid can degrade faster than standard service intervals suggest. Maintaining this system requires precision diagnostics to ensure the software and hardware remain perfectly synchronized.
Maintaining Efficiency with Audi CVT Transmission Repair
The Multitronic system, or CVT, is designed for those who value a smooth, stepless driving experience. While efficient, these systems rely on a complex arrangement of belts and pulleys. Audi CVT transmission repair often focuses on the wear and tear of these internal components. If the car begins to "shudder" under acceleration or feels like it is slipping, it is usually a sign that the internal tension or fluid pressure is failing. Proactive maintenance is vital here, as CVTs are less forgiving of neglect than traditional automatics.
The Nuances of Audi Automatic Transmission Repair
The Tiptronic system is Audi’s version of a traditional automatic, found in many of their larger SUVs and luxury sedans. Audi automatic transmission repair for these models often involves addressing the torque converter or valve body. While robust, the intense UAE heat can lead to fluid oxidation, which causes the gears to hunt or shift harshly. A dedicated technician will look beyond the surface to ensure the "brain" of the transmission is communicating correctly with the engine.
The Classic Feel: Audi Manual Transmission Repair
Though less common in the region’s luxury market, Audi manual transmission repair remains a necessity for performance enthusiasts and older models. These repairs typically center on the clutch assembly, synchros, and gear linkages. The desert dust can sometimes infiltrate the external linkages, leading to a stiff or "notchy" shift feel that requires professional cleaning and lubrication.
Recognizing the Warning Signs Before Failure
Your Audi is designed to communicate its health through both digital warnings and physical feedback. Catching a problem early is the most effective way to save money on European car service in the UAE.
Delayed Engagement: If you shift into "Drive" or "Reverse" and there is a noticeable pause before the car moves, your fluid pressure might be low or the internal seals could be failing.
Slipping Gears: If the engine revs up but the car doesn’t speed up accordingly, the transmission is "slipping." This is a classic sign that you need an immediate Audi transmission service or potentially a clutch replacement.
Unusual Noises: Whining, clunking, or grinding noises are never a good sign. In DSG models, a mechanical "clacking" can indicate a failing dual-mass flywheel.
The "Limp Mode": Audi vehicles often enter a protective "limp home" mode when a serious electronic or mechanical fault is detected. This limits the gears you can use to prevent further damage.
Why the UAE Climate Impacts Your Gearbox
In Abu Dhabi and Dubai, the climate is the primary enemy of mechanical longevity. The standard service intervals written for European temperatures simply do not apply here.
Factor
Impact on Audi Gearbox
Recommended Action
Extreme Heat
Fluid thins out and loses lubricity, leading to friction.
Increase frequency of fluid flushes.
Fine Desert Dust
Can clog coolers and contaminate fluid if seals are weak.
Regularly check and replace transmission filters.
High Humidity
Moisture can mix with fluid, lowering its boiling point.
Use only high-grade, synthetic OEM fluids.
Stop-Go Traffic
Creates immense thermal load on clutches and mechatronics.
Ensure the cooling system is functioning at 100%.

The Importance of Audi Transmission Service
Think of a transmission service as a "wellness check." It involves draining the old, heat-stressed fluid, replacing the internal filter, and cleaning the pan of any metallic debris. For many UAE drivers, performing this service every 40,000 to 60,000 kilometers is the best insurance policy against a total gearbox failure.
Audi Gearbox Overhaul vs. Audi Transmission Rebuild
If the internal components have suffered significant wear, a more intensive approach is needed. An Audi gearbox overhaul generally involves replacing seals, gaskets, and worn clutch plates. An Audi transmission rebuild is even more comprehensive, where the entire unit is disassembled, cleaned, and every component is inspected against factory specifications. This is often the most cost-effective way to restore a high-mileage vehicle to "factory fresh" performance without the astronomical cost of a brand-new unit.
When Is Audi Transmission Replacement Necessary?
In cases of catastrophic failure—such as a cracked housing or a completely fried mechatronic unit that has damaged other internals—an Audi transmission replacement may be the only viable option. While this is the most expensive route, using a brand-new or a certified re-manufactured unit ensures that your car remains reliable for another decade of desert driving.
